Matthew Paul Well water
1 October 2013 | 14 replies
A UV light will need to have the bulb changed probably every year.One investor that I know claims that a disgruntled tenant continually ran the water to saturate the septic and drain field, causing him to spend $25,000 for a new system, immediate afterwards he sold the property.Shallow dug wells are susceptable to all kind of pollution including fertilizer, chemical and natural, septic systems, insects and even a decaying animal.
